]]></description><link>https://forums.opera.com/post/120697</link><guid isPermaLink="true">https://forums.opera.com/post/120697</guid><dc:creator><![CDATA[borisliv]]></dc:creator><pubDate>Sun, 14 May 2017 04:28:06 GMT</pubDate></item><item><title><![CDATA[Reply to Rendering Engine on Fri, 12 May 2017 22:06:15 GMT]]></title><description><![CDATA[<p dir="auto">Correct, Opera Mini uses Presto running on our servers, that means that if we change the engine, we only need to do it server-side, you don't have to update your Opera Mini application. In most cases you should not bother how websites are detecting Opera Mini, whether as Opera Mini or Opera 12.16.</p>
